Re: [心情] 前辈拒绝导入任何其他工具....

楼主: yauhh (小y宝贝)   2014-05-18 12:12:09
原po挖了四个坑,但不代表我们总是要在这四个坑里思考.
但我们有些建议是要你不要卡在这个坑里想事情,你却说,不懂你的心情.
那么说穿了,就是情绪而已嘛! 情绪有什么重要的吗?
我觉得,的确不想要管你的心情,因为我们讨论,是认真看事情.
从这四个坑来看,牵涉到的就是工作环境.
那你知道不知道,你绝对有权决定自己的工作环境该如何配置,
但你没有那么多的权力,要大家都配合你,一起来用相同的办法配置工作环境.
那就好像,你的办公室隔间是你自己的工作区域,别人不该随便侵入.
那你知道,单元测试可以自己一个人写,而且可以先写程式再写单元测试吗?
那你知道,如果你不想用CVS但那是别人管的,但你可以自己本机装个git来管好自己的
版本吗? 甚至,如果做得很好,你可以展示给前辈看,建议部门自己作个版控的proxy,
而不是建议直接换掉别人管的CSV.
那你知道,当你说明EL的好处的时候,并没有同时说明EL的坏处吗?
上司要看的是什么? 上司要看的,是你真的把事情当作事情看,而不是当作你心爱的
事情看. 当你喜欢一个事情时,你只是热忱地嘴砲,那为什么别人不能驳回呢?
就说EL的事情,真要能说服别人,请你很明白地开列一张表格,标明旧工具与新工具之间
具体的优点评比,以及具体的缺点评比. 要有具体的评比,而不是像你私心满满
只说EL的好处以及旧方法的坏处. 明确的report是很有效的工具,就算前辈看完了,
仍然决定不要用EL,那也是他衡量了之后做了判断. 决策权在上司.
我觉得EL可怕的地方在,它把一些资料存在session状态中,当我要回头追那些资料的
来源时,我深深地感受到,倒不如写嵌入程式码还比较清楚.
然后,我要说,你这些建议都只是在做工具的选择,那在这期间,你有为了这一些东西,
努力做过多少事情吗? 而且当你屡次提出建议,却都没有被接受时,有这么多次失败,
你有想过你的问题在哪里吗?
公司的工作方式究竟有没有问题,你要先研究过之后,能说出问题的处境,以及要达成的
解决目标,然后才有所谓解决方法的研拟. 但是,现在只是在没有提出问题的情况下,
一堆没来由的所谓解决方法飘来飘去,其他那些好好在做事的人可能觉得很烦吧.
※ 引述《dream1124 (全新开始)》之铭言:
#1
: 在我进公司一个多月时, 建议要写单元测试, 让测试不会完全只能手动,
: 结论:被打枪, 但我接受这个说法
#2
: 进公司三个月后, 我建议换掉 CVS 版控系统, 因为太旧不符开发需求,
: 这时候前辈跟我说版控系统是维运部门管的, 我们这边基层改不了,
: 这种政治问题很麻烦, 很难处理又要教会大家很多东西....
: 结论:继续打枪, 虽接受这个说法但有点失望
#3
: 进公司五个月后, 我建议使用相依性管理工具, 建构各种不同的build,
: 而且感觉不出比起 Ant 好在哪里, 为什么不能只用 Ant 建构专案....
: 结论:还是打枪, 我的不满开始累积
#4
: 最近一次的事件, 让我有快暴发的感觉....
: 前辈无意间发现我的 jsp 页面里面, 为了让语法更简洁,
: 写了 expression language 而没有用指定的 Struts 1 bean:write 标签
: 因此叫我向上级写一分报告解释使用 EL 有什么好处, 也许有机会导入
: 于是我以为自己嗅到一些改变的风向
: 很开心地分析, 从政治的观点告诉他们这东西是 jsp 本来就有的规格,
: 不用引入一堆lib也能用, 问题很单纯
: 从开发的角度告诉他们能让语法更简洁, 也不会影响到其他已经写好的程式
: 最后.... 还是被打枪! 以后不能使用了!
: 前辈说, ${} 的语法感觉跟 jQuery 有点像, 怕其他开发者会弄错,
: 而且它能做的事情原本就能做到, 感觉不到用了以后有少明显效益,
作者: Ting1024 (无)   2014-05-18 13:35:00
+1
作者: yyc1217 (somo)   2014-05-18 14:49:00
我也觉得若git推不起来 自己本机用得爽爽就好
作者: greatroy (没有暱称)   2014-05-18 14:53:00
讲白点,就是一个年轻菜鸟自以为知道些好用的新玩意儿,希望那些老头们可以抛开过去,迎向未来,但却不了解不同公司不同部门不同单位都有各自的特性,ERP首重稳定,想要改用新玩意儿,只有稳定中求发展一途,而不是幻想大家应该配合你的想法及做法才是原PO满脑子一定是想这些老头真的是不知上进,不知世界变了若有机会,在公司再多待个几年,或许就能体会到,自己的想法有多么天真无邪~~
作者: xxxzzz (...)   2014-05-18 19:42:00
+1
作者: ravi (对手太弱了 @@)   2014-05-18 23:08:00
+1
作者: TonyQ (自立而后立人。)   2014-05-19 03:38:00
原文大部分同意,但 EL 并没有要求你一定要把资料存在session 吧。他不过就是个 variable resolver 。你高兴也可以用 ${param} 等取代啊,应该没什么特别之处(?)他只是一种取用资料的表达语言(expression language)。是不是跟别的什么东西弄混了。@@

Links booklink

Contact Us: admin [ a t ] ucptt.com